Accident Summary Nr: 141163.015 - Employee fractures arm when caught in cement chute

Accident Summary Nr: 141163.015 -- Report ID: 0355118 -- Event Date: 11/11/2021
Inspection NrDate OpenedSICNAICSEstablishment Name
1563998.01511/16/2021327332Concrete Pipe & Precast

Abstract: At 11:10 a.m. on November 11, 2021, an employee was working for a firm that manufactured concrete pipe. He was inside a cement chute, replacing a rubber seal on the backside of the chute. The chute activated while his right arm was inside. His arm became caught by the chute. The employee suffered a broken right arm. He was hospitalized. The UPA said that he suffered a fractured right elbow from being caught in a concrete chute.
